Biotrophic Fungal Pathogens: a Critical Overview.

Biotrophic fungi are plant pathogens that feed on living cells, causing significant crop damage. Understanding their infection mechanisms and host immune responses is key to developing disease-free crops.
Area of Science:
- Plant Pathology
- Mycology
- Crop Science
Background:
- Biotrophic fungi are a diverse group of pathogens classified by their nutritional mode, feeding exclusively on living host cells.
- They cause substantial crop losses worldwide, posing challenges for investigation and treatment development.
- Examples include Blumeria graminis, Puccinia graminis, and Phytophthora infestans, impacting various crops.
Purpose of the Study:
- To review the infection mechanisms of biotrophic fungi in host plants.
- To elucidate the host immune responses triggered by biotrophic fungal pathogens.
- To emphasize the understanding of biotrophic fungal biology and pathogenesis for developing control strategies.
Main Methods:
- This review synthesizes existing literature on biotrophic fungal-plant interactions.
- It examines the molecular and cellular processes involved in fungal infection and host defense.
- Focus is placed on understanding pathogenicity at the molecular level.
Main Results:
- Biotrophs develop specialized structures like haustoria for nutrient absorption from living plant cells.
- Pathogens secrete effector molecules to evade host immune responses, while plants activate defense mechanisms.
- The complex host-pathogen interactions and signaling pathways are crucial for pathogenicity.
Conclusions:
- A comprehensive understanding of biotrophic fungal infection and host immunity is essential.
- This knowledge can guide the design of novel strategies to overcome fungal resistance.
- The ultimate goal is to develop methods for creating disease-free crops and mitigating economic losses.
